Abstract

Herein, we report a mild protocol for direct visible-light-initiated Giese addition of unactivated alkyl iodides to electron-poor olefins (Michael acceptors) with catalysis by decacarbonyl dimanganese, Mn<sub>2</sub>(CO)<sub>10</sub>, an inexpensive earth-abundant-metal catalyst. This protocol is compatible with a wide array of sensitive functional groups and has a broad substrate scope with regard to both the alkyl iodide and the Michael acceptor.
